WELCOME TO NORTHERN PATAGONIA & THE LAKES

The provinces of Neuquén and Río Negro, in northern Patagonia, boast a wild and rugged landscape of diaphanous lakes, and luxuriant forests and meadows.

While there are plenty of opportunities for eating well and relaxing with a good book, the focus in Patagonia is on outdoor pursuits. Every mountain, stretch of grassland, river and lake appears to have been created to fulfil the dreams of riders, fishermen and walkers.

Northern Patagonia’s fly-fishing for rainbow and brown trout is among the finest and most picturesque in the world. The region also boasts two of the continent’s best golf courses and wonderful opportunities for bird-watchers. Come winter (July through September), Bariloche and San Martin de Los Andes offer spectacular skiing.

TRAVELLING DEEPER

Characterised by pristine lakes, dense forests, and expansive meadows, serves as a sanctuary for those seeking both tranquility and adventure.

The region’s clear waters and untouched wilderness make it a premier destination for fly fishing, offering serene moments in pursuit of rainbow and brown trout. For the more adventurous, the mountains and grasslands provide endless opportunities for hiking, horseback riding with gauchos, and exploring the rugged terrain on bike or foot. The vibrant towns of Bariloche and San Martin de Los Andes come alive in winter with some of the best skiing in South America, while the warmer months reveal golf courses and bird-watching excursions that showcase the region’s diverse flora and fauna.

We have selected a handful of boutique hotels and gloriously remote lakeside lodges to suit any occasion. Those who like getting their hands dirty can stay on a working estancia, setting out each morning with the gauchos to herd cattle, stopping for asado (traditional Argentine barbecue) lunches of prime beef or fresh trout before enjoying a doze in the shade or a dip in the river.
